Low-carbon building corollary equipment
The invention relates to the technical field of low-carbon buildings, in particular to low-carbon building corollary equipment which comprises a fixing sleeve, the fixing sleeve is fixedly connected to a building outer wall, and a wedging mechanism can be matched with a rotating shaft so as to ensure that the whole cleaning equipment can move on a curtain wall through gravity. The defect that a traditional building curtain wall is manually cleaned through a lifting rope is overcome, so that the energy consumption is greatly reduced, and the purpose of low carbon is achieved; the cleaning mechanism can rotate forwards and backwards to wipe according to different movement tracks of equipment, a cleaning agent can be pushed in in the wiping process, additional energy supply is not needed in the wiping process, and therefore the energy consumption is reduced while the curtain wall cleaning effect is guaranteed.
